The Amazing World of Gumball is Coming Back this December


Cartoon Network has been the hub for amazing new shows like Adventure Time and Steven Universe, and earlier this year we had the final season of The Amazing World of Gumball. With the show ending on a cliffhanger, it's been revealed that we might get a proper sendoff this coming December.

According to Animation Magazine, The Amazing World of Gumball is coming back with a series of special episodes called Darwin's Yearbook. The episodes are said to focus on Darwin as he goes around Elmore Junior High asking around for which teacher deserves a special slot in the yearbook.
